The key difference between Blu-ray disc players and recorders and current optical disc technology is that Blu-ray, as its name commends, uses a blue-violet laser to read and write info instead of a red one. Blue light has a shorter wavelength than red light, and according to the Blu-ray Disc Association ( BDA ), which is created up of, among others, Sony, Philips, Panasonic, and Pioneer, this suggests that the laser spot can be focused with bigger precision.
